I'm just getting into MySQL, so forgive me if this is a basic question. For my application I need to migrate my database from SQL Server 2008 R2 to MySQL.

Is there any mechanism or technique or suggestion or tips or magic tricks for migration?

Moving the data is the easy part. The T-SQL code all needs to be checked to ensure that you aren't using any SQL Server specific features like TOP, CTEs, SQL CLR, etc and that'll all need to be converted. Even if there's a tool to convert it, you'll need to test everything to make sure that everything is still working the way that you want it to be working.
